martok / palefill

Inject Polyfills for various web technologies into pages requiring them
https://martok.github.io/palefill/
Mozilla Public License 2.0
79 stars 9 forks source link

Problem on www.mediamarkt.de #66

Closed AstroSkipper closed 1 year ago

AstroSkipper commented 1 year ago

Hello martok! First of all, many thanks for your great palefill extension! Much appreciated! I know you are German like me. Have you ever ordered items from the MediaMarkt Online Webstore? Basically, the website MediaMarkt works in New Moon and Serpent (BTW, palefill 1.23 is installed), but there is a problem with the page Account Overview (Kontoübersicht) after logging in. It isn't loaded correctly, and no information can be viewed only on this page. Can this be fixed via palefill?

Kind regards, AstroSkipper drwurmdin.gif

martok commented 1 year ago

Moin! Ich glaub ich hab im Leben zwei mal was in so einer Kette gekauft, entweder gibts nix oder sinnlos teuer. "Ich bin doch nicht blöd" :laughing:

Don't even get to that point though, the registration page already has a Regex problem. That one looks easy, but yours might be another one. Is there anything printed to the console?

AstroSkipper commented 1 year ago

smilie_m_006.gif Ich habe tatsächlich einige gute Schnäppchen dort geschlagen, insbesondere an Aktionstagen! Zuletzt am Black Friday!

At the moment, I am on my Android tablet. The login process in New Moon and Serpent works. But, the account overview doesn't, unfortunately. Tomorrow, I will check the console output and report here. In any way, thanks in advance for your interest! mevoila.gif

AstroSkipper commented 1 year ago

Moin! I tested the Media Markt website in Serpent 55 with palefill 1.24 installed. Opening the Account Overview (Kontoübersicht) results in an invalid regexp group error in the web console. Here is a screenshot:

Media-Markt-Konto-bersicht-in-Serpent-55-Console.png

Hope it will help you. If you need additional information, do not hesitate to ask me!

Cheers, AstroSkipper b025.gif

martok commented 1 year ago

Ah, same file I'm also seeing. Can you test how far you get with the attached build?

palefill-1.25a0.xpi.zip (rename to palefill-1.25a0.xpi because Github attachment policies...)

AstroSkipper commented 1 year ago

Ah, same file I'm also seeing. Can you test how far you get with the attached build?

palefill-1.25a0.xpi.zip (rename to palefill-1.25a0.xpi because Github attachment policies...)

moinmoin.gif martok! Thank you so much! Very good work! You are a kind of magician for me! I tested the MediaMarkt Online Webstore with your new version (**by changing maxVersion to 55.*) in Serpent 55. Everything works as it should. The Account Overview is fully functional and visible again. I logged out of my account and then logged in again, no problems anymore. I am so happy. This project here is the most important for me to stay with my old, beloved UXP browsers**. Thank you so much again for your great work!

10.gif

Kindest regards, AstroSkipper smilie_d_002.gif

AstroSkipper commented 1 year ago

martok! I also tested the MediaMarkt Online Webstore with your new version in New Moon 28. Same result! It works like a charme. From now on, I am able to visit this online shop with my UXP browsers again. My utmost respect!

Once again, thank you very much! goodjob.gif

martok commented 1 year ago

Das war ja einfach :+1:

New release coming up in a few minutes...

(**by changing maxVersion to 55.***)

... also with that included.